ABOUT SCRIBE Scribe is where exceptional people come to do the best work of their careers. More than 94% of the Fortune 500 use Scribe to own their specialized intelligence: the unique way their teams work, decide, and get things done. Our Specialized Intelligence platform automatically captures how work happens and turns it into a living asset that helps people and AI agents do their best work. We're growing fast, since our founding in 2019, we've grown to 7 million users across 600,000 businesses. Based in San Francisco, we've been named a LinkedIn Top Startup, are valued at over $1 billion, and are backed by leading investors. Join us in our mission to transform how people do work. 📌 ABOUT THE ROLE GTM Systems owns Salesforce architecture, HubSpot administration, LeanData routing, enrichment infrastructure, CPQ, and the Salesforce-Django-ERP billing integration, several of which sit on the critical path for closing revenue and invoicing customers. It's a one-person function today, and the roadmap has outgrown what one person can execute alone. As GTM Systems Manager, you'll build inside an existing architecture, take ownership of well-scoped workstreams, and grow into more ambiguous, higher-stakes systems problems as you prove yourself out. 🛠️ WHAT YOU'LL DO - Build and maintain Salesforce flows, validation rules, page layouts, and permission sets within existing architectural patterns - Own production support: triage outages, broken automation, and access issues, resolving or escalating inside SLA - Keep LeanData routing graphs (Lead, Contact, Account) accurate as the business changes - Run the enrichment stack day to day, including Clay and PDL workbook upkeep, credit monitoring, and CRM hygiene - Administer HubSpot campaign architecture and lead routing configuration - Partner with the Senior Manager, GTM Systems on CPQ configuration alongside Deal Desk - Close out well-defined tickets on the Salesforce-Django-ERP order-to-cash integration with Engineering 🔍 WHAT WE'RE LOOKING FOR - You've spent 5 to 7 years deep in Salesforce administration, RevOps, or GTM systems, and admin fundamentals, flows, validation rules, permission sets, page layouts, sandbox-to-production change management, are second nature - You can pick up an existing architecture and build cleanly inside it without needing to redesign it first - Day-to-day admin, ticket triage, and production support don't feel like a step down to you - Your changes don't break things, and when they do, you catch it in sandbox before it ships - You use AI-native tools like Claude or Cursor as a daily operating tool, not an occasional novelty - You want a path from well-defined execution today toward architecture ownership tomorrow ✨ NICE TO HAVE - Salesforce Administrator certification - Experience with LeanData, Clay, or CPQ platforms - Exposure to a Salesforce-to-ERP or billing integration - Background in B2B SaaS, ideally PLG or hybrid GTM models 🚫 THIS ROLE IS NOT FOR YOU IF - You want to define architecture on day one; this role builds within existing patterns and earns ownership over time - You'd rather advise than execute; this is hands-on configuration and admin work, not a strategy seat - You see production support and ticket triage as beneath you 📍 LOCATION REMOTE, WITH A REQUIREMENT TO BE BASED PERMANENTLY IN THE UNITED STATES OR CANADA. 💰 COMPENSATION Salary varies by location.
